17114
P0730
2 Dcy
Gear
ATF dirty or level not OK
- Check ATF level page 37-24 .
Incorrect Ratio
Clutch slipping or malfunctioning
Solenoid valve dirty or malfunctioning
- Check using output Diagnostic Test Mode (DTM) page 01-72 .
Sensor for transmission RPM -G182- malfunctioning
- Carry out corrective actions for DTC 17100/P0716.
Sender for transmission output RPM -G195- malfunctioning
- Carry out corrective actions for DTC 17968/P1560.
TCM incorrect or incorrectly coded
- Check TCM identification page 01 -19 .
Notes for malfunction recognition of DTC 17114/P0730: When testing the full braking RPM, the transmission input speed (in the converter with a transmission range engaged) must be close to zero at a standstill. Otherwise, this malfunction is stored, since clutch damage could occur. Read measuring value block, display group 001 page 01-80 .
TCM gear monitoring checks the relationship between transmission input and output speeds with respect to the drive range selected. This malfunction is stored when that relationship is implausible.

Now I have figured it out, if you have lost a gear such as Tozo did with 2nd or others have with reverse, there is something ripped or broken inside the gearbox.
But if you don't have any other ratio fault codes and all the gears work some of the time, a fluid and filter change out works a lot of the time to keep the tranny running for months or years.
